Two years after the introduction of the Lufthansa Private Jet (LPJ), demand for individual, flexible air travel is so strong that Lufthansa is expanding its premium service. The company is investing in its own private jets to augment the existing Lufthansa Private Jet service. The new aircraft will be purchased next year and fitted with exclusive interiors. Lufthansa’s own jets are expected to go into service in spring 2008.

As Lufthansa is setting up its own LPJ service, cooperation with the previous provider NetJets Europe will cease in February 2008. Until the fleet has reached the required size for 2008, individual LPJ flights will be operated by partners certified by Lufthansa.
